TL 发表于 2004-11-12 20:58:27

双机互联传输速度问题

2台机子A和B,XP系统,A是主版集成1000M/100/10自适应网卡,B是100/10M网卡...用100M的网线直连....

在网上邻居里B机从A机直接复制一个大小为300M的文件用时约几十秒,估计速度应该是100M网线的最大速度,也就是10多M/s,但如果在A机上用SERV-u建立一个FTP,在B机上用快车登陆以后同样下载那个300M的文件,速度最高却只有900多k/s...这是怎么回事的?........

为什么速度会差异那么大?~...

sammyweed 发表于 2004-11-12 22:36:10

回复: 双机互联传输速度问题

如果允许多线程..然后网际快车多线程下..估计可以达到理论值...

这个东西很容易理解....但是解释起来就.......只能说可能是直接的传输只用到OSI模型的网络层,数据链路层,物理层...而用FTP就要涉及更高的那四层...由此增加了网路开销.....- -||

汗啊~~~~~难道我是计算机网络读疯了

JayZ 发表于 2004-11-12 23:36:35

回复: 双机互联传输速度问题

快车的线程是有冲突的。
建议使用单线程,并将网络设置里面设置为1000M。

上杉和也 发表于 2004-11-13 00:29:30

回复: 双机互联传输速度问题

局域网内,请尽可能使用Windows提供的共享功能,FTP额外的开销是比较大的,HTTP的开销更大。

TL 发表于 2004-11-13 08:20:34

回复: 双机互联传输速度问题

线程多了的确有提高,但我试开了20左右,速度仍然没有达到最大~

3楼是什么意思?~~...不是很明白...

另外2楼说的不对吧,应用层应该是一切应用,直接传输当然也属于应用层的

sammyweed 发表于 2004-11-13 16:13:45

回复: 双机互联传输速度问题

3楼可能是要你在快车的选项----连接里把"连接类型/速度"改一下,改成其他,然后后面数字是1000M的说

PS:都说那个OSI模型是偶瞎说的说....最近正被此郁闷着....

残酷天使 发表于 2004-11-14 00:03:20

回复: 双机互联传输速度问题

一个子网里的传输最好不要使用涉及IP层以上的应用,因为传输过程中是不需要检验太多IP地址与MAC转换的.直连最好。

dajiadihao 发表于 2004-11-14 18:36:59

回复: 双机互联传输速度问题

汗二楼的。。。

allstar 发表于 2004-11-15 16:17:20

回复: 双机互联传输速度问题

网络邻居也是属于应用层的好不好?!和ftp同样处在一层。而且,ftp的传输效率,比网络邻居要高得多。至于出现ftp只有900多kb/s,有多种原因。比如Serv-U本身配置问题(有限速),FlashGet配置问题(多线程或有限速),甚至FlashGet本身写得就有问题。
页: [1]
查看完整版本: 双机互联传输速度问题